Chapter 1 Biodiversity Date :________ 1

1. Biodiversity originates from the world bio which means living thing and diversity means
variety.
2. Biodiversity or a variety of biology refers to the variety of living organisms on the Earth
that consist of plants, animals and microorganisms.
3. Biodiversity exists as the result of a variety of habitats and climate.
4. Scientists estimate that there are roughly 13 million species of animals and plants even
though only 1.75 million have been identified and given names systematically.
5. As a country rich in biodiversity, Malaysia is also known for endemic species which are
almost extinct on the face of the Earth.
6. The government has taken initiatives to protect these species by establishing preservation
and conservation centers, enforcing laws as well as raising awareness among the society.
1.1.1 Importance of biodiversity

Herbal plants that grow in forests are used widely in the field of medicine and
Medical
cosmetic.
Food source Humans gain food source from plants and animals.
Human do research on animals, plants and microorganisms to create new
Education
technology.
Recreational and Areas that are rich in biodiversity become attractions and have the potential to
ecotourism spots generate the country’s economy.
Balance in The nutrient cycle and interaction between various species control the balance
nature of organism population.
Raw material Timber, rattan and rubber are examples of plant crops which are used to make
industry daily product.
Oxygen a
and carbon Plants absorbs carbon dioxide and release oxygen during photosynthesis
dioxide balance
Temperature
Tall plants form canopies to protect the grounds from scorching hot sun rays.
control

1.1.2 Effective Biodiversity Management


1. Humans need to manage biodiversity well in order to ensure all flora and fauna are
protected and do not become extinct.
2. Among some of the human activities that could destroy biodiversity are:
a) Logging which can destroy forests that are habitats for flora and fauna.
b) Illegal hunting to get valuable animals will reduce the number of animals including
endemic species like the Sumatera rhinoceros and orangutan.
c) Deforestation without control agriculture could cause these species to lose their
habitats and migrate or die

3. Steps to protect biodiversity


a) Protecting organisms
that are likely to be harmed by banning the killing and trading of animals as well as
enforcing punishment on the offense
b) Replanting trees
that have been cut to maintain the species of the trees
c) Cutting only selected trees
like the big and mature ones to avoid them from being extinct
d) Protecting habitats
by establishing national parks, Ramsar sites, forest reserves, marine parks and
wildlife sanctuaries
e) Establishing rehabilitation centres
for endemic species to be taken care of and reproduce
f) Banning illegal logging
by enforcing heavy punishment to the perpetrator
g) Carrying out awareness campaigns
through mass media to increase awareness among the society about the necessity of
maintaining balance in biodiversity for the plants, animals and the future generation
